University Of Detroit Commit Calmly Breaks Rim On Breakaway Slam
Pickerington Central’s (Ohio) Adrian Nelson, who’ll be a Detroit Titan next year, delivered a literally show-stopping highlight tonight in his game against Groveport Madison. Given the opportunity for a wide-open dunk, Nelson showed off his strength (and maybe some weakness in the Groveport gym) by collapsing the rim beyond easy repair. And all he does afterwards is casually gaze on his destruction.
According to the Pickerington Central Twitter, the game has been canceled and will be rescheduled. Always leave them wanting more, Adrian.
